DANGER: RISK OF ELECTROCUTION
Make sure that the system is earthed properly.
Turn OFF the power supply before servicing.
Install the switch box cover before turning ON the power supply.

CAUTION
Do NOT perform the test operation while working on the indoor units.
When performing the test operation, NOT ONLY the outdoor unit, but the connected
indoor unit will operate as well. Working on an indoor unit while performing a test
operation is dangerous.
CAUTION
Do NOT insert fingers, rods or other objects into the air inlet or outlet. Do NOT
remove the fan guard. When the fan is rotating at high speed, it will cause injury.

DANGER: RISK OF ELECTROCUTION
All electrical parts (including thermistors) are powered by the power supply. Do NOT
touch them with bare hands.
DANGER: RISK OF ELECTROCUTION
Disconnect the power supply for more than 10minutes, and measure the voltage at
the terminals of main circuit capacitors or electrical components before servicing.
The voltage MUST be less than 50VDC before you can touch electrical components.
For the location of the terminals, see the wiring diagram.
